How salary is taxed in Ireland

Income tax in Ireland is progressive: marginal rates rise from 20% to 40% as income grows. Employees also pay social contributions of around 6.14% of gross salary. A tax-free allowance of about โ‚ฌ20,000 per year is deducted before income tax. The standard VAT rate is 23%. For example, a gross salary of โ‚ฌ4,394 per month leaves about โ‚ฌ3,633 net, after โ‚ฌ492 income tax and โ‚ฌ270 in social contributions, an effective deduction rate of 17.33%.

Income tax brackets in Ireland (2026)
Annual taxable incomeTax rate
Up to โ‚ฌ44,00020%
โ‚ฌ44,000 and above40%
